Quasithin Groups,f the finite simple groups. In January 1996, the authors began work toward a new and more general classification of quasithin groups; the paper gives an exposition of the approach and considerable progress to date.

The Residually Weakly Primitive Geometries of the Janko Group ,,,v-ity condition RWPRI: For each flag ., its stabilizer acts primitively on the elements of some type in the residue Γ.- We demand also that every residue of rank two satisfies the intersection property.

Aspects of Buildings,geometry, gets a bit strange in infinite rank. Some precise description of the departure of these two concepts in infinite rank is given. Some speculations are offered about which “classical” infinite-rank geometries may still possess characterizations by point-line axioms.

Generalized Quadrangles Arising from Groups Generated by Abstract Transvection Groups,urthermore, if the abstract transvections of Γ act as linear transvections on some finite-dimensional vector space over a commutative field of characteristic ≠ 2, we construct a weak embedding of Γ in a projective space, which is full over a subfield. This yields that Γ is a symplectic or a hermitian quadrangle in this case.
